Merge tag 'drm-fixes-2024-12-14' of https://gitlab.freedesktop.org/drm/kernel

Pull drm fixes from Dave Airlie:
 "This is the weekly fixes pull for drm. Just has i915, xe and amdgpu
  changes in it. Nothing too major in here:

  i915:
   - Don't use indexed register writes needlessly [dsb]
   - Stop using non-posted DSB writes for legacy LUT [color]
   - Fix NULL pointer dereference in capture_engine
   - Fix memory leak by correcting cache object name in error handler

  xe:
   - Fix a KUNIT test error message (Mirsad Todorovac)
   - Fix an invalidation fence PM ref leak (Daniele)
   - Fix a register pool UAF (Lucas)

  amdgpu:
   - ISP hw init fix
   - SR-IOV fixes
   - Fix contiguous VRAM mapping for UVD on older GPUs
   - Fix some regressions due to drm scheduler changes
   - Workload profile fixes
   - Cleaner shader fix

  amdkfd:
   - Fix DMA map direction for migration
   - Fix a potential null pointer dereference
   - Cacheline size fixes
   - Runtime PM fix"
